Toxodon Platensis
March 13, 2025
Toxodon - Wikipedia Protein is the clue to solving a Darwinian mystery | Max-Planck-Gesellschaft Toxodon V2 | SciiFii Wiki | Fandom Toxodon Platensis
March 13, 2025
Toxodon - Wikipedia Protein is the clue to solving a Darwinian mystery | Max-Planck-Gesellschaft Toxodon V2 | SciiFii Wiki | Fandom Toxodon Platensis